Q. What are electromagnetic waves?
As-per to Maxwell a speed up charge is a source of electromagnetic radiation. In an electromagnetic wave electric as well as magnetic field vectors are at right angles to each other and both are at right angles to the direction of propagation. They possess the wave character as well as propagate through free space without any material medium. These waves are oblique in nature.
